Spoon

1754-1761 (made)
Artist/Maker
Place of origin

Rounded bowl with gilt border enclosing a gilt cross with roundel at crossing, moulded band at base of stem with 3 bevelled panels, the knop shaped as a hatched inverted cone topped by 4 strawberry leaves with hoops

Marks and inscriptions
On the underside of the stem at the back: maker’s mark HW in monogram for Hans Wiggman of Kalmar (working 1712-1761), control mark the 3 crown mark in force from 1754.
Object history
Purchase - (£3.10.0) Bernal Sale, 23 April 1855, lot 2348


From Catalogue of Scandinavian and Baltic Silver, RW Lightbown, V&A, 1975, p116: Acquired as German or Scandinavian ‘about 1600’.
